Can A Retail Salesperson Afford Rent in Harrisburg, PA?

Rent-burdened — rent takes 45.2% of gross income.

Harrisburg rent: July 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Pennsylvania state estimate).

Harrisburg median rent
$1,382/mo
Retail Salesperson salary (Pennsylvania)
$36,699/yr
Rent as % of income
45.2%
Gross monthly income works out to about $3,058, and the 30% rule supports up to $917/mo in rent. Harrisburg's median rent of $1,382 exceeds that threshold by $465/mo, putting a retail salesperson salary into the rent-burdened range here. A retail salesperson works roughly 78.3 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Pennsylvania state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Harrisburg, PA.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
